An evaluation of phase analysis on diagnosis of the patients with myocardial infarction

Phase analysis was evaluated on detection of regional wall motion abnormality of the patients with myocardial infarction (MI). From multigate date obtained by first pass method in RAO and by equilibrium method in LAO projection, the quantitative amplitude and phase at the small ROI in the left ventricle were calculated by using Fourier transform at fundamental frequency. Regional amplitude was expressed as regional ejection fraction (REF). REF and regional phase value (RPH) thus calculated in 24 patients with anterior and inferoposterior MI were compared with those of 10 normal controls. RPH showed significant reverse correlation with R-R interval and was needed for correction by R-R interval on intercases comparison. On the other hand, no correlation was observed between REF and R-R interval. Corrected RPH at the infarcted areas of MI patients showed significant delay compared with those at the corresponding regions of normal controls. REF at the infarcted regions was significantly decreased compared with REF of normal controls. REF calculated from the data in RAO was more sensitive for detection of anterior and infero-posterior MI than those calculated in LAO projection. RPH and REF were useful to analyze regional wall motion abnormality of myocardial infarction. (author)
